About this role
We will give you all the training and support you need so you will develop your skills as part of our team. You don’t need to have any experience – we’ve got you covered. You can also get some lunch and travel costs too. Whatever you need, we’re here to help.

When you’re in our busy stock room, you get first peek at donated gems and turn them into stunning outfits to fight fast fashion. On the shop floor you can learn about serving customers, helping donors, fillings rails, and making eye-catching displays.

Whatever your passion, we’ll teach you to use your creativity and style to make your shop sparkle. Why not try a bit of everything?

Prepare donations including sorting, steaming and pricing
Create stylish window displays
Keep the shop floor rails looking full and perfect
Put your creativity to good use by upcycling
Slow down fast fashion by making the most of our fantastic donations

What happens next?
After you apply the manager will ask you to come in for an initial chat. This is not an interview, just a chance to get an idea of what you'd like to do in the shop. From there you can meet the rest of the volunteer team and get involved with whatever area of the shop takes your interest!
 
Age Range: We can accept applications for under 18s, including from 16+.
